Critique My HostPlus Super Allocations

I'm overweight emerging markets by about 3% which I'm okay with (if I held them at market cap weight, they would be 6% of the total portfolio). They aren't included in the indexed international share investment options which is why I've invested in them separately.

I was under the impression that overweighting the Australian allocation is a sensible idea to gain exposure to franking credits assuming that they aren't 100% priced in.

As I stated in the original post, I'm concerned about having exposure to property and infrastructure because any unlisted assets may be mispriced by the fund managers due to conflicts of interest assuming that their pay is performance based. If HostPlus had indexed options for these funds I might consider investing in them, but they are both actively managed.
